次の方法で共有


The property <property name> cannot be deleted because it is participating in the association <association name>

 

公開日: 2016年4月

選択されたプロパティは、エラー メッセージに示されているクラス間の関連付けに対する関連付けプロパティとして設定されています。プロパティがデータ クラス間の関連付けに関与している場合、そのプロパティを削除することはできません。

関連付けプロパティをデータ クラスの別のプロパティに設定して、目的のプロパティが正常に削除されるようにしてください。

このエラーを解決するには

  1. O/R デザイナーで、エラー メッセージに示されているデータ クラスを接続する関連行を選択します。

  2. 行をダブルクリックして、[関連付けエディター] ダイアログ ボックスを開きます。

  3. [関連付けのプロパティ] からプロパティを削除します。

  4. プロパティの削除を再試行します。

参照

O/R Designer Overview
How to: Create an Association (Relationship) Between LINQ to SQL Classes (O/R Designer)
Walkthrough: Creating LINQ to SQL Classes (O/R Designer)
LINQ to SQL